Response to Request
Your FOI request is approved.
Attached is the data from Cagayan Valley Medical Center (CVMC) and Epidemiology Bureau in response to your request
At present, the Epidemiological Modeling and Research Division (EMRD) of the Epidemiology Bureau can only provide national data since the subnational data are still under embargo. However, we can provide Global and Philippine data (latest available is 2019) generated from the Global Burden of Disease (GBD) study. Please see attached file. For more information about the GBD study and their publicly available data, you may access their site at https://www.healthdata.org.

Your right to request a review
If you are unhappy with this response to your FOI request, you may ask us to carry out an internal review of the response by writing to DOH Central Appeals and Review Committee, at foi@doh.gov.ph. Your review request should explain why you are dissatisfied with this response, and should be made within 15 calendar days from the date when you received this letter. We will complete the review and tell you the result within 30 calendar days from the date when we receive your review request.
If you are not satisfied with the result of the review, you then have the right to appeal to the Office of the President under Administrative Order No. 22 (s. 2011).
